In this review of the VGKE 15.6' laptop the bottom line is simple: it is a well-priced, no-frills machine for students, remote workers and anyone who needs a responsive, large-screen laptop for everyday tasks. The standout reason to buy is the combination of a low-power Intel Celeron N5095 and 12GB DDR4 memory, which together deliver snappy performance for web browsing, video streaming and office work without excessive heat or noise. The review focuses on real-world use rather than flagship benchmarks.
Key Features
- 10nm Intel Celeron N5095: The quad-core processor provides efficient multitasking and low power draw for longer battery-friendly sessions.
- 12GB DDR4 RAM: Dual-channel memory noticeably improves responsiveness when switching between browser tabs and productivity apps.
- 256GB SSD: A solid-state drive delivers fast boot times and file access compared with a mechanical hard disk.
- 15.6' Full HD IPS display: The 1920 x 1080 panel with a 5.9mm bezel gives a roomy viewing area and anti-glare treatment to reduce eye strain.
- Full-size backlit keyboard: A complete keyboard with numeric keypad and backlight makes typing in dim light and number entry convenient.
- Fingerprint reader: Built-in biometric login adds a quick, more secure way to unlock the laptop and protect personal data.
Who It's For
This laptop is aimed at students, home office users and light creative workers who need a large, comfortable screen and steady everyday performance without a high price tag. The 12GB RAM and SSD make it a good fit for anyone who keeps many tabs open, runs office suites, watches high-definition video and values a responsive system.
Those who need heavy video editing, 3D rendering or modern gaming should look elsewhere because the Celeron N5095 is designed for efficiency and general productivity rather than sustained high-end graphics workloads. Power users who require high-capacity storage or discrete graphics will also find the specifications limiting.

Specifications
| Processor | Intel Celeron N5095 quad-core 2.90 GHz |
| Memory | 12GB DDR4 dual-channel |
| Storage | 256GB SSD |
| Display | 15.6' 1920 x 1080 Full HD IPS, 5.9mm bezel, anti-glare |
| Keyboard | Full-size backlit with numeric keypad |
| Security | Fingerprint reader |
